daysBetween()
2 つの日付間の日数を返します。この関数は、foreach ステートメントでのみ有効です。
構文
daysBetween(date1, date2)
date1 には、開始日を指定します。
date2 には、終了日を指定します。
使用方法
date1 を date2 より後の日付にすると、返される日数が負の数値になります。
daysBetween() は、foreach() ステートメントで使用する必要があります。この関数は、group by、order by、filter ステートメントでは使用できません。
例
各商談を完了するのに何日要したでしょうか? daysBetween() を使用します。
1q = load "DTC_Opportunity";
2q = foreach q generate daysBetween(toDate(Created_Date_sec_epoch), toDate(Close_Date_sec_epoch) ) as 'Days to Close';
3q = order q by 'Days to Close';例
各商談は何日間開かれているでしょうか? daysBetween() と now() を使用します。
1q = load "DTC_Opportunity";
2q = filter q by 'Closed' == "false";
3q = foreach q generate daysBetween(toDate(Created_Date_sec_epoch), now() ) as 'Days to Close';
4q = order q by 'Days to Close';